Understanding the Oxygen Production Process

Plants produce oxygen through a process called photosynthesis. During photosynthesis, plants use sunlight, water, and carbon dioxide to create their own food (sugars) and release oxygen as a byproduct.

The amount of oxygen a plant produces depends on several factors, including:

  • Leaf surface area: Larger leaves mean more surface area for photosynthesis.
  • Light intensity: Plants need sunlight to photosynthesize, and brighter light generally leads to higher oxygen production.
  • CO2 concentration: Higher CO2 levels can actually increase photosynthesis and oxygen production.
  • Species-specific factors: Different plant species have different photosynthetic rates.

2. Phytoplankton:

  • Source: A StackExchange question titled "What plant produces the most oxygen?"
  • Quote: "The largest oxygen producers are actually phytoplankton in the ocean, not plants on land."

Analysis: This statement highlights the often-overlooked role of phytoplankton in oxygen production. These microscopic algae are found in the world's oceans and are responsible for producing a significant portion of the oxygen we breathe. Their abundance and rapid growth rate make them crucial players in the global oxygen cycle.
